The Division of Iowa Trial Court System into Eight Judicial Districts: Enhancing Efficiency and Access to Justice
The Iowa Trial Court System is divided into eight judicial districts, each serving a specific geographical area within the state. This division plays a crucial role in ensuring the smooth functioning of the court system and facilitating access to justice for all residents of Iowa.
Key Benefits of this Division:
- Efficiency: By organizing the court system into eight judicial districts, the workload is distributed evenly, allowing for more efficient handling of cases and reducing backlog. This division helps streamline court operations and ensures that cases are processed in a timely manner.
- Local Expertise: Each judicial district is staffed with judges and court personnel who are familiar with the local laws, procedures, and community dynamics. This localized approach ensures that cases are adjudicated effectively and in line with the specific needs of each district.
- Convenience: The division of the court system into eight judicial districts makes it easier for individuals to access legal services and attend court proceedings. By having courts located in various regions across the state, residents can resolve their legal matters without having to travel long distances.
- Specialization: Some judicial districts may focus on specific types of cases, such as family law, criminal law, or civil matters. This specialization allows judges and court personnel to develop expertise in particular areas of law, resulting in more informed and consistent decision-making.
